#114ad5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#114ad5 is composed of 6.7% red, 29%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92% cyan, 65.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 222.6 degrees, a saturation of 85.2% and a lightness of 45.1%. #114ad5 color hex could be obtained by blending #2294ff with #0000ab.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

#114ad5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#114ad5 has RGB values of R:17, G:74, B:213 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0.65,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 1133269.
